Gaithersburg is a city in Montgomery County and is noted for its ethnic and economic diversity. A WalletHub study dubbed the area the second most ethnically diverse city in the country. Separated by east and west sections, the city provides two distinct atmospheres.

What to Look for When Selecting a Treatment Center in Gaithersburg, MD

The Right Program: A detailed interview and assessment process with a clinical professional. Look for an organization that assesses physical and mental health, as well as qualifications for your loved one’s specific needs. Make sure the organization you’re considering has skilled experience with the the drawbacks your loved on is facing.

If the organization isn’t right for your substance abuse treatment, ask if they have referrals for a more appropriate fit.

Professional Team: Look for a licensed, experienced organization that focuses on a team-oriented approach, working together to support each client and their family. Find a team that includes individual and family therapists, substance abuse counselors, psychiatrists, and dietitians.

A highly credentialed team taking a holistic approach to care is critical to achieving successful outcomes from substance abuse and addiction treatments.

Teens doing music therapy session with a guitar

Safety: An organization that focuses on participant safety, both physical and emotional. Many people will discover through the treatment process that abstinence from all substances is the best choice for them. Through this journey, it is important to support participants in staying safe and reducing harm.

Find a support system you trust to aid your substance abuse and addiction treatment.

Mental Health and Trauma Training: drug abuse and addiction generally co-occur with a mental health or trauma experience. It is important that a treatment program has the ability to treat not only substance abuse but also underlying mental health concerns and trauma. Ideally, a program would have a psychiatrist on staff, and staff trained in trauma-informed care.

A good support system believes recovery and healing are two sides of the same coin, and both are necessary for long-lasting success.

An Individualized Program: an organization that tailors the experience to the individual and their unique needs. Find a team that sees you or your loved one as a person and creates a support program based on what is needed. True change from substance abuse and addiction treatment comes from authentic connection and genuine investment.

Strengths Based: An approach that focuses on what is working and nurtures those activities, patterns, and behaviors to encourage health and vibrancy.

Evidence-Based Care: an organization that draws on research and time-tested practices for the best possible outcome. Research or ask about the therapy methods they use in addition treatment.

Family Oriented: Any large life challenge always affects and is impacted by the surrounding system. Find an organization that supports and integrates the whole family. No one walks the road to recovery alone.

Maryland’s Opioid Crisis

On March 1, 2017, Governor Larry Hogan issued an executive order to declare a state of emergency regarding the opioid overdose crisis in Maryland. The implementation was based on the state’s overdose fatality data, prescribing data, and seizure data.

The emergency declaration was intended to increase the state’s efforts to reduce the number of fatalities and non-fatal overdoses to coordinate programs for prevention, enforcement, treatment, and recovery services.

How Gaithersburg is Managing its Public Health

Opioid Intervention Team

Each of Maryland’s 24 jurisdictions were assigned an opioid intervention team to be led by an emergency manager and health officer. Each team coordinates with the community to create opioid-fighting strategies at the local level. Each team focuses efforts on several areas such as:

  • Public education and awareness – Teaching in schools and the community about the risks of addiction and
    how to prevent it.
  • Public safety/overdose prevention – Naloxone training and dispensing to the public, school health nurses and law
    enforcement.
  • Increased access to treatment – For those who are looking for detox, residential or outpatient programs. As well as continued support for those who have been hospitalized or incarcerated.
  • Coordination, communication and planning – Tracking overdose data to target prevention and intervention resources.

Montgomery County STEER

Stop, Triage, Engage, Educate and Rehabilitate (STEER) guides people struggling with addiction through the treatment and rehabilitation process. Its goal is to direct people in need of substance abuse treatment away from jail and into an intervention program.

It is a different way to provide treatment options to individuals who are drug-involved, but who did not necessarily present a chargeable offense when encountered by law enforcement.
